AAA: Sugar Land Space Cowboys (6-8) won 6-2 (BOX SCORE)

McCullers got the start for Sugar Land and pitched well in his rehab outing tossing 4 scoreless innings with 5 strikeouts. Sugar Land got on the board in the first inning on a Price RBI single. In the 3rd they scored 3 runs on a Whitcomb RBI double and Price 2 run HR. Short added a 2 run HR in the 5th to extend the lead. Blubaugh closed it out tossing 4 scoreless innings with 8 strikeouts as Sugar Land won 6-2.


AA: Corpus Christi Hooks (3-5) won 2-0 (BOX SCORE)

Fleury started for the Hooks and was dominant striking out 9 over 6 scoreless innings allowing just 1 hit. Sherwin put the Hooks on the board in the 4th inning with an RBI single. In the 5th, Cerny connected on a solo HR to extend the lead. Dombroski tossed 2 scoreless innings in relief and Sanchez closed it out with a scoreless 9th as the Hooks won 2-0.


A+: Asheville Tourists (3-4) won 5-2 (BOX SCORE)

Pena started for Asheville and pitched well allowing just 1 unearned run over 4 innings while striking out 3. The offense got on the board in the 4th inning on a Gomez solo HR. In the 5th they got a Jaworsky RBI double. Urias relieved Pena and allowed a run over 2.1 innings. Leach was dominant in relief striking out 4 over 1.2 scoreless innings. In the bottom of the 7th, Guillemette connected on a 3 run HR to send the fans home happy with the walk-off as Asheville won 5-2.


A: Fayetteville Woodpeckers (3-5) 

Game 1 – won 8-6 (BOX SCORE)

The offense got on the board scoring 3 runs in the first on an error and a bases loaded walk to Cauro and Hernandez. Rodriguez got the start and allowed 3 runs over 3.1 innings. The offense stormed back with 4 runs in the 4th inning on a Villarroel 2 run double, run scoring on a wild pitch and a Brutcher RBI single. Cruz relieved Rodriguez and also allowed 3 runs over 3.1 innings. Cauro added an RBI single in the 6th inning. Brown came on and got the final out as the Woodpeckers won 8-6.

Game 2 – won 6-0 (BOX SCORE)

Hertzler started game two for the Woodpeckers and pitched really well striking out 7 over 4.2 scoreless innings. The offense got on the board in the 2nd inning on Trujillo and Valencia RBI singles. They got 3 more in the 4th on a Trujillo 2 run HR and Spence RBI single. Villarroel added some insurance in the 6th with an RBI double. Burleson closed it out tossing 2.1 scoreless innings as the Woodpeckers won 6-0.
